landry 97894fe4c9 Update to rust 1.22.1.
full changelog at https://blog.rust-lang.org/2017/11/22/Rust-1.22.html

port changes:
- switch to clang and libc++ (instead of egcc and estdc++)
- use devel/llvm instead of the embedded llvm version
- make i386 produce code for 'pentiumpro' instead of 'pentium4' so that
ppl can use ripgrep on pentium II's (yay!)
- use a hack (codegen-units=16) to fix memory pressure issues on i386.
  Might not work forever.....

tested on i386 & amd64, went into an i386 bulk.
